At a press conference prior to the match between Independiente Santa Fe and Atlético Bucaramangawhich will be played this Saturday, June 8 at the Alfonso López stadium in the capital of Santander, the leopard team coach Rafael Dudamel described it as “persona non grata in the city” to Carlos Antonio Vélez.

The comment was made after the sports journalist’s mentions about the Venezuelan’s technical direction.

Two days ago, journalist Carlos Antonio Vélez said that Dudamel was a motivational person and that the leopard team’s home run was mediocre.

“To all those people who are against Atlético Bucaramanga, our fans are very clear about it, He is a persona non grata in Bucaramanga. Not only for the team, for the city” said the technical director when he gave his opinion on Vélez’s comments.

He added “unwelcome people in the city are those who in a mediocre, arrogant and “Ignorant people try to detract from what the finalists have done over the 6 months.”

There are just a few hours left to start one of the most anticipated matches for the leopard fans, a situation that the team coach recognized as unique not only for him, but for all those who have accompanied Atlético.
